Bottoms

(129)
 
New arrivals
£ 32.00
New arrivals
New arrivals
Made with wool
New arrivals
£ 28.00
New arrivals
New arrivals
£ 13.00
New arrivals
£ 28.00
You have seen 48 of 129 articles. Load next